The Ruby Violet red beryl mine is located in the south-eastern part of Utah, about 25 miles west-southwest of the city of Milford. This is a relatively arid and sparsely populated region of the United States. The arrow marks the location of the open pit mine from which exceptional red beryl crystals are mined from a white volcanic rhyolite host rock. BACK
